    Job Overview

    Performs professional level work developing, organizing, administering, and evaluating assigned programs and functions, providing guidance and technical expertise to assigned program staff, other departments, the community, and program participants. Incumbent may coordinate one or more specialized programs.

    Ideal Candidate

    The ideal candidate for this position will be able to provide nutritional services on behalf of Hillsborough County Health Care Services department which includes but is not limited to: nutrition counseling, education, menu planning and development of educational materials. In addition, work with staff to develop, organize, administer and evaluate community and program participants.

    This individual must be detailed-oriented, have the ability to work independently, and also exhibit effective training and strong communication skills and a minimum of a Bachelor of Science degree from a Nutrition/Dietetics Program that is recognized by the Accreditation Council for Education in Nutrition and Dietetics (ACEND).

    The candidate must be able to communicate well and have the ability to motivate people to make healthy choices and lifestyle changes. They should also have experience with teaching/training individuals and groups.

    This position will primarily work in the south county locations: SouthShore Community Resource Center and Wimauma Suncoast Healthy Living Fitness Center. They will also be required to work in as well as our Lee Davis and Plant City locations as well. Therefore, dependable transportation to these locations is required on a regular basis. The selected candidate must be willing to perform this function as it is an essential responsibility in this role.

    It is also mandatory that this individual is able to communicate in both English and Spanish, both written and verbally.
